    Bayan’s Q1 revenue reaches P1.51B 
     
    By Lenie Lectura
    Reporter
     

    Bayan Telecommunications Inc. said revenue in the first quarter of the year rose 20 percent to P1.51 billion from a year earlier.

    “Comparing it with the revenues in the first quarter of last year, our first quarter revenues for 2008 grew... 20 percent,” Bayan chief executive consultant Tunde Fafunwa said in an interview.

    The unit of Benpress Holdings Corp. recorded P1.26 billion in revenue during the first quarter of 2007. For the full year of 2007, revenues reached P5.5 billion from P4.8 billion recorded a year earlier.

    Net income surged to P2.2 billion in 2007, up 319 percent from P526 million in 2006, aided by foreign exchange (forex) gains.

    “There was a significant income last year because of forex gains. This year, we see the same impact of a stronger peso,” added Fafunwa.

    In 2007, the peso averaged P41 against the US dollar. Analysts see the peso improving this year to about P35. “What is important to us is that our revenues continue to grow because growth in revenues is a key indicator of a company’s performance,” Fafunwa said.
